Job Description

You will lead the entire development process from the planning phase through the development and testing process to successful daily releases to our customers.

You will work closely with Product Managers, Program Managers, Professional Services, HR, and others in R&D.

Together we'll produce an advanced platform that meets the highest security standards and NFRs.

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ead and mentor multiple engineering teams, ensuring high performance and career growth.

  • Drive the development, delivery, and operations of CyberArk’s SaaS platform, ensuring reliability, security, and scalability.

  • Align engineering efforts with business objectives, ensuring timely and quality delivery of platform capabilities.

  • Promote a culture of innovation, collaboration, and continuous improvement.

  • Defining aggressive goals for the group and the product while leading the group to achieve these goals

  • Communicate with internal stakeholders to understand what to build (and what not to build)

  • Take a crucial role in architectural and strategic decisions

Requirements

  • 3+ years of experience as a group manager focusing on SaaS products.

  • Strong leadership and ownership.

  • Ability to manage, track, and identify risks, bottlenecks, and challenges ahead of time and oversee technical coordination to resolve them

  • Ability to initiate and lead large-scale processes to completion

  • Enthusiastic about architecture, design, testing, and performance

  • Proactive, highly motivated individual with a high work ethic and goal-oriented approach

  • Excellent communication and presentation skills

  • Ability to drive technical excellence while balancing business needs and strategic goals.

  • Bachelor's Degree in Science, Programming, or Engineering related field / Elite unit alumni

Advantages:

  • Background in identity security, privileged access management, or cybersecurity

  • Prior experience as a group leader in a platform team

  • Experience in compliance-heavy environments (FedRAMP, SOC2, etc.)

  • Leading teams that create infrastructure services for various internal customers while guaranteeing scalability, reliability, and efficiency.

  • Cross-functional leadership and collaboration beyond direct teams working with PM, legal, peer services
